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court held that the review jurisdiction under Order 47 Rule 1 CPC is limited to correcting errors apparent on the face of the record and cannot be used to challenge the correctness of a prior order on merits. The Court found that the review petition filed by the judgment debtors did not meet the criteria for review, as it failed to identify any such error. Consequently, the Court set aside the order of the High Court that had reversed the earlier decision, thereby reinstating the original order of the Executing Court.
